In today's digital age, the way we consume information has drastically changed. One of the most significant innovations in this realm is the rise of the webcast, which has transformed how organizations communicate with their audiences. A webcast is essentially a broadcast over the internet, allowing real-time streaming of audio and video content to viewers worldwide. This technology has become increasingly popular among businesses, educational institutions, and even government agencies as a means to reach a larger audience without the geographical limitations of traditional media. The advantages of using a webcast are numerous. First and foremost, it provides an interactive platform where viewers can engage with the content being presented. Unlike traditional broadcasts, which often limit audience participation, a webcast allows for live Q&A sessions, polls, and feedback mechanisms that enhance viewer engagement. This interactivity not only makes the experience more enjoyable for the audience but also provides valuable insights for the presenters. Furthermore, a webcast is cost-effective. Organizations can save on travel expenses, venue rentals, and other associated costs that come with hosting a physical event. Instead, they can invest in high-quality production equipment and software to ensure that their webcast reaches its full potential. This democratization of information dissemination means that even small organizations can compete on a global stage, sharing their messages without the financial burden typically associated with large-scale events. Another significant benefit of a webcast is the ability to reach a global audience. In an interconnected world, geographical boundaries are becoming less relevant. A company based in New York can effectively present its products to potential clients in Tokyo, all through the power of a webcast. This opens up new markets and opportunities that were previously unattainable for many organizations. The ability to archive and share webcasts also means that content can be accessed long after the live event has concluded, further extending its reach. However, there are challenges associated with webcasting that organizations must navigate. Technical issues such as poor internet connectivity or software glitches can disrupt the viewing experience, leading to frustration among audiences. To mitigate these risks, it is essential for organizations to conduct thorough testing and have contingency plans in place. Additionally, creating engaging content is crucial; simply broadcasting a presentation without considering the audience's needs may result in low viewership and engagement. In conclusion, the emergence of webcasts has revolutionized the way information is shared and consumed. With their ability to connect people from different parts of the world in real-time, webcasts offer a unique blend of accessibility, interactivity, and cost-effectiveness. As technology continues to evolve, it will be exciting to see how webcasting further develops and shapes the future of communication. Organizations that embrace this medium stand to benefit significantly, reaching wider audiences and fostering deeper connections than ever before.
